Long breath. "What do you need?"

"I need you to know I'm alive. And I need you not to ask me where I'm going next."

"Going? Summer..."

"I'm leaving Charleston. I can't stay. I need you to trust me."

"I trust you. But if he hurt you..."

"Don't. Not now."

"Okay." His voice is rough. "You call me. Anything. Three in the morning. I don't care."

Autumn. The harder call. She'll hear what I haven't said yet.

She answers immediately. "You're at your parents'?"

"Yeah."

"Did you find what you needed at the house?"

"I left him my rings. I left him a note. I left him a wastebasket of pictures."

"Good."

"Autumn. I'm not staying here. I can't be in Charleston while he figures out how to apologize. I'll be at my parents' tonight. Tomorrow I'm gone."

"Where."

"I don't know yet. North. Anywhere I'm not Mrs. Bennet."

A long breath. The sound of someone trying to hold steady for me. "Call me when you stop driving. I don't care what state. I don't care what time. Call me."

"I will."

"I love you, Summer."

"I love you too."

***

I plug in my phone. Set my alarm for five.

I lie in my childhood bed. Same twin mattress. Same quilt Mama made. Same bookshelf full of paperbacks with cracked spines.

I let one thought through the wall.

Eight photos. Posted by the firm where his father is the patriarch and his mother is the queen. They wanted me to see. They wanted me to know.

The thought sits in my chest like a coal.

I don't cry.

I set my alarm.

I'm gone before sunrise.
